**Onboarding note: Spare hardware storage**

Night-shift staff at Fennwick Labs occasionally need replacement keyboards, cables, or monitors. These are kept in Storage Room B, at the end of the level 2 corridor past the print station. Please log anything you take on the clipboard inside the door so stock can be tracked. The room stays locked overnight, and you will need the door-pass code to enter:

door code, yagap-bahof: bdg-O-05

**14:32 — Compression tradeoff identified.** The Briarlane gateway team confirmed that enabling per-message deflate on websocket channels reduced bandwidth by roughly 40% but introduced context-takeover behavior we had not threat-modeled. We disabled compression on authenticated channels pending review, accepting higher egress costs. For the security reviewer: the exact gateway build under analysis is recorded via the trace token below.

build token for yajof-bajof: htk31_506ff1188f74596b5bb2eec94edc43c

### RestockPilot: Release Prerequisites

Before cutting a release, confirm that the RestockPilot planner can reach the SnackGrid inventory service, since the build pipeline runs an integration smoke test against staging during packaging. A failed handshake here blocks the release tag, so verify credentials first. The pipeline reads its staging credential from the deploy config; for reference and manual verification, the current key appears below.

service key, tajof-fawip: vxb4-JNOz

Ticket PAY-412: payroll export switched from CSV to fixed-width without notice, breaking the Marlow importer.

Repro:
1. Open Ledgerline staging.
2. Run export for any pay period.
3. Inspect output — columns misaligned.

Expected: CSV per the v3 spec. Actual: fixed-width. Blocks contractor onboarding. To pull the export via API and confirm, authenticate with the bearer token below:

portal login ticket: eyJhbGciOiJIUzI1NiIsInR5cCI6IkpXVCJ9.eyJzdWIiOiIwEOsktwVNwIn0.-UJU3fdyyCgG